    Question Graphics Card

    I have 2 things to ask one I was thinking of buying a newer graphics card and looking to spend under $100 I think I like the GeForce 9600 GT Graphics Card its like $80 number. 2 will my CPU handle this card ? I have a pentium 4 3.06ghz
    with 1 gig ram

    it's not the CPU that you have to be concered about...........it's the GPU interface which I'm betting is AGP........... and therefor is not compatable with your P4 MotherBoard.... can't put a PCI-e card in a AGP slot

    go here to see all the graphics cards http://www.techarp.com/article/Deskt...idia_4_big.png

    I have a P4 with an AGP also at 3.06..I put an ATI HD3850 AGP card in....the best one available.......the next card down from that is the HD1950 and then the HD1650 and then X800.........

    With the HD 3850 and 3g RAM, I can play BF2142, (on full) Fallout3 (on full) Crysis (on high, I have DX10 with this but lags on Ultra)...you get the picture

    i gave you the list.......... ATI HD3850 is the top AGP card ever.....period! DX10......320 stream......overclockable........
    however it will not matter as your CPU will bottleneck so you only need a HD1950 or HD1650 would do nicely you can see here the ati cards http://www.techarp.com/article/Deskt.../ati_4_big.png

    the gigabyte card is fine but the ATI card had twice the memory bus 128 gigabyte vs 256 for the ATI and the same for the next one

    ........buy whichever is in your budget and they will all work........make sure you have enough RAM and Power Supply
